jim_giraffe wrote:£45 for deathshrouds ?
really?
tataros come with alot more for £36
guess i cant afford these
I don't see any tataros terminators on the FW site. Maybe I'm missing them.
The Justaerin terminators are £35 with no weapons, and the weapons cost £12, making them £47 for 5.
The Cataphractii are £33 with no weapons, and the weapons cost either £12 or £16 (depends on the set), making them £45 or £49 for a set of 5.
Not that I think that £45 is reasonable.
